I have an active interest in VPS hosting (there's the disclaimer for you!), but am based in the EU and thus I'm not involved in the US hosting business (but previously was). Nevertheless, I still remain interested in seeing what offers are available across the pond, and thus I did a bit of digging on 'JCKD'. First, I decided to research their VPS panel URL:
ldn20-mbp:~ Theo$ host manage.jckd.co.uk
manage.jckd.co.uk has address 98.142.221.45
ldn20-mbp:~ Theo$ host manage.virpus.com
manage.virpus.com has address 98.142.221.45
ldn20-mbp:~ Theo$ host 98.142.221.45
45.221.142.98.in-addr.arpa domain name pointer private.dnsslave.com.
See the similarities yet? Virpus' manage URL A record shares the same IP as JCKD's. Doing a lookup on that, the RDNS shows 'private.dnsslave.com', a subdomain of dnsslave.com, and although this isn't acknowledged publicly, it's Virpus' reseller VPS domain designed to mask themselves for their resellers. As a VPS provider, we do the same as Virpus and have an anonymous domain for our VPS nodes so customers can resell if they want.
ovz-robles.dnsslave.com is one of the Virpus VZ node hostnames. That resolves to 173.0.48.9.
Who owns that IP block (173.0.48.0/20)? Oh yeah, Virpus.
I'm not saying that reselling is bad, and if JCKD offers you some *value added* stuff such as server management, uptime monitoring, free backups etc, it may well be worthwhile, but given Virpus' pricing, it's unlikely they're getting much of a discount for reselling.
Given the above, you may want to take a look at Virpus directly and see if they offer you a better deal, as going through the reseller route means more companies will be seeking to profit from the same offering. You also have to be wary that you are depending on your *reseller* paying their bills - if they fail to pay them, you go offline. It's one extra bit in the matrix of suppliers you have to account for.
In this case, Virpus offers this package, as does JCKD:
Basic
50 GB Disk Space
1000 GB Bandwidth
512MB Guaranteed RAM with 2GB Burst
2 IP Addresses
JCKD charges $8.72/mo, whereas Virpus charges $7. They're also charging more for cPanel, DirectAdmin, IP addresses etc. I strongly suggest you enquire as to if you're going to receive some sort of management or other benefit from being with the other provider.
